Transaction 14d7e53b99695767bde3503dbf54350c975d1999260d1771002f43a614871494
1 Input
1 Output
-
14d7e53b99695767bde3503dbf54350c975d1999260d1771002f43a614871494:0
- value
- 1921787
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b145923a033fb529dec05f846c09a087414c93f OP_EQUAL
- address
- 3JkCfEWbuYAig2RCQiZM1T1m1yAxQbaAZ3